Tuesday evening, 5:47 PM. My 3-year-old was having a complete meltdown because her sock felt “too bumpy,” my husband was stuck in traffic, and I was staring at my empty meal plan like it might magically produce dinner ideas.
Then I spotted ground beef in the freezer and a box of spaghetti in the pantry, and something clicked. What if taco night crashed into pasta night? What if I could throw everything into one pan and call it a day?
Forty-five minutes later, my sock-sensitive toddler was asking for seconds, my husband was texting from the driveway asking what smelled so good, and I was feeling like the dinner hero I rarely feel like on weeknights.
This one-pot taco spaghetti bake has become my go-to when life gets messy and dinner needs to just work. Cheesy, spicy, satisfying, and dirty dish count: exactly one pan.
Perfect.
Why This Taco Spaghetti Bake Will Save Your Weeknight
It’s ridiculously easy – Brown some beef, dump in the rest, and let the oven finish the job. Even on your most scattered days, you can pull this off.
One pan, one mess – After a long day, the last thing I want is a sink full of pots and pans. This entire meal happens in one oven-safe skillet.
Kid-approved flavors – The taco seasoning gives it just enough zip without being too spicy for little palates. My picky eater calls this “the good spaghetti.”
Stretches your grocery budget – A pound of ground beef feeds our family of four with leftovers for lunch the next day.
Customizable heat level – You can dial the spice up or down depending on who’s eating. More on that below.
One-Pot Taco Spaghetti Bake Recipe

This recipe serves about 6 people generously, though in my house it sometimes disappears faster than expected. Here’s what you’ll need:
Ingredients
| Ingredient | Amount |
| Ground beef (80/20 works great) | 1 lb |
| Taco seasoning | 4 tbsp |
| Yellow onion, diced | ½ small |
| Olive oil | 2 tbsp |
| Rotel tomatoes, undrained | 10 oz can |
| Water | 3 cups |
| Spaghetti noodles, uncooked | 8 oz |
| Sharp cheddar cheese, shredded | ⅔ cup |
| Fresh cilantro, chopped | ⅓ cup |
Tools You’ll Need
- Large oven-safe skillet (cast iron works beautifully)
- Wooden spoon or spatula
- Sharp knife and cutting board
- Measuring cups and spoons
- Oven mitts
Optional Add-ons for Extra Flavor
- Diced bell peppers for crunch and color
- Black beans for extra protein
- Corn kernels for sweetness
- Jalapeños for heat lovers
- Sour cream and avocado for serving
Step-by-Step Instructions

Step 1: Prep Your Oven and Ingredients
Preheat your oven to 350°F. While it’s heating, dice your onion into small pieces and get all your other ingredients within reach. Trust me, once you start cooking, things move quickly.
Step 2: Brown the Beef
Heat the olive oil in your large oven-safe skillet over medium-high heat. Add the ground beef and break it up with your spoon as it cooks.
Cook for about 5-7 minutes until it’s mostly browned with just a few pink spots remaining. If there’s a lot of grease pooling, drain off the excess, but leave a little for flavor.
Step 3: Add the Aromatics
Toss in your diced onion and cook for another 2-3 minutes until it starts to soften and smell amazing. The onion should be translucent and the beef should be completely browned by now.
Step 4: Season Everything
Sprinkle the taco seasoning over the beef and onions, stirring well to coat everything evenly. Cook for about 30 seconds until fragrant.
This is where your kitchen starts smelling like a taco shop, and everyone mysteriously appears asking what’s for dinner.
Step 5: Add the Liquid Base
Pour in the entire can of Rotel tomatoes, juice and all. This is crucial – don’t drain them! That liquid helps cook the pasta and adds flavor.
Add the 3 cups of water and stir everything together. It will look soupy, but don’t panic. The pasta will absorb most of this liquid as it cooks.
Step 6: Add the Pasta
Break the spaghetti noodles in half (makes them easier to manage) and add them to the skillet. Use your spoon to push them down so they’re mostly submerged in the liquid.
Bring everything to a boil, then reduce heat to medium-low, cover, and simmer for 10-12 minutes. Stir every few minutes to prevent sticking.
The pasta should be al dente and most of the liquid should be absorbed when it’s ready.
Step 7: Top and Bake
Remove the lid and sprinkle the shredded cheddar evenly over the top. Don’t be stingy here – the cheese creates a beautiful golden top that everyone fights over.
Transfer the skillet to your preheated oven and bake for 15-20 minutes until the cheese is melted, bubbly, and golden brown in spots.
Step 8: Finish and Serve
Remove from the oven (careful, that handle is HOT!) and sprinkle the fresh cilantro over the top. Let it rest for about 5 minutes to set up, then serve directly from the skillet.
The first bite should give you perfectly cooked pasta, melted cheese, and all those taco flavors in one amazing forkful.

Storage and Reheating
Leftovers keep beautifully in the fridge for up to 4 days. I usually transfer them to a regular container since storing the cast iron skillet in the fridge isn’t practical.
To reheat, microwave individual portions for about 90 seconds, stirring halfway through. For larger portions, reheat in a 350°F oven for about 15 minutes until warmed through.
You can also freeze this for up to 2 months. Thaw overnight in the fridge before reheating.
Substitutions and Variations
Ground turkey instead of beef – Works great for a lighter option, though you might need to add a bit more seasoning.
Different cheeses – Mozzarella gives you more stretch, pepper jack adds heat, or try a Mexican cheese blend for authentic vibes.
Fire-roasted Rotel – Adds a subtle smoky flavor that takes this to the next level.
Vegetarian version – Use plant-based ground “meat” or extra beans and vegetables.
Spice level adjustments – Use mild Rotel and reduce taco seasoning to 3 tablespoons for sensitive palates, or add diced jalapeños and hot sauce for heat lovers.
Nutritional Information
| Nutrient | Per Serving (serves 6) |
| Calories | 420 kcal |
| Fat | 22g |
| Protein | 20g |
| Total Carbs | 36g |
| Fiber | 3g |
| Net Carbs | 33g |
Note: Values are approximate and may vary based on specific brands and portion sizes.
Perfect Pairings
This dish is pretty complete on its own, but here are some sides that complement it beautifully:
- Simple green salad with lime vinaigrette to cut through the richness
- Tortilla chips and guacamole for extra taco night vibes
- Mexican street corn if you’re going full theme night
- Cold beer or margaritas for the grown-ups
Common Mistakes and How to Avoid Them
I’ve made this recipe probably 30 times, and I’ve learned from every mistake. Here’s how to avoid the most common pitfalls:
Adding too much water. Stick to exactly 3 cups. More water means soupy pasta that never quite comes together. I learned this the hard way when I “eyeballed” it once.
Not stirring the pasta enough. Those noodles will stick together and to the bottom of the pan if you don’t stir every few minutes. Set a timer to remind yourself.
Draining the Rotel. That juice is liquid gold! It adds flavor and helps cook the pasta. Keep every drop in there.
Frequently Asked Questions
Can I use fresh tomatoes instead of Rotel?
You can, but you’ll need to dice about 1 cup of tomatoes and add an extra ¼ cup of water. You’ll also lose some of that signature Rotel flavor.
What if I don’t have taco seasoning?
Make your own by mixing 1 tablespoon chili powder, 1 teaspoon each of cumin and paprika, ½ teaspoon each of onion powder and garlic powder, and ¼ teaspoon cayenne.
Is this too spicy for kids?
It has a mild kick but isn’t truly spicy. If you have very sensitive eaters, use mild Rotel and reduce the taco seasoning slightly.
Can I make this ahead of time?
You can prep it through step 6, then refrigerate for up to a day before adding cheese and baking. Add about 5 extra minutes to the baking time if starting from cold.
Final Thoughts
This one-pot taco spaghetti bake has honestly saved my weeknight dinner sanity more times than I can count. It’s the kind of recipe that makes you look like you have your life together when really you’re just winging it with pantry staples.
The beauty is in its simplicity and flexibility. You can customize it based on what you have in your fridge, adjust the spice level for your family, and have dinner on the table in under an hour with minimal cleanup.
Whether you’re dealing with picky eaters, a crazy schedule, or just want something comforting and delicious, this recipe delivers every single time. It’s become one of those dishes my family requests by name, and I suspect it’ll become one of yours too.
Give it a try the next time you’re staring at the clock wondering what’s for dinner. Your future self will thank you!